Ré#7b13 Guitar Chord — Chart and Tabs in Cmaj7 Tuning

Short answer: Ré#7b13 is a Ré# 7b13 chord with the notes Ré♯, Fax, La♯, Do♯, Si. In Cmaj7 tuning, there are 10 voicings. See the fingering diagrams below.

How to Play Ré#7b13 on Guitar

Ré#7b13, Ré#7-13

Notes: Ré♯, Fax, La♯, Do♯, Si

x,8,7,9,0,6 (x324.1)
x,8,7,6,0,9 (x321.4)
x,8,7,9,11,7 (x21341)
x,8,7,7,11,9 (x21143)
3,3,1,3,0,x (2314.x)
3,3,1,x,0,3 (231x.4)
3,6,7,6,0,x (1243.x)
3,6,x,6,0,3 (13x4.2)
3,6,x,3,0,6 (13x2.4)
3,6,7,x,0,6 (124x.3)
